What we do
The program seeks to build a new generation of young leaders who will drive transformation with integrity, resilience, and compassion.
Built around interconnected pillars that together nurture leadership, civic engagement, peacebuilding, entrepreneurship, and ethical values. It focuses on experiential learning, dialogue, reflection, and community service, preparing young people to rebuild their communities and lead Africa toward a more just and peaceful future.
Leadership & Governance
Ethical and Transformative Leadership in Afrika
. Explore principles of servant and transformative leadership.
. Understand governance systems and accountability.
. Build skills for ethical decision-making.
Peacebuilding & Conflict Transformation
Building Peaceful and Resilient Communities
.Causes of conflict and social healing.
. Dialogue, mediation, and negotiation.
. Gender and peacebuilding.
. Reconciliation and restorative justice.
Environment & Sustainability
Youth for a Green and Sustainable Africa
. Promote environmental awareness and climate action.
. Encourage ecological responsibility in community development.
. Equip youth with practical environmental project skills.
Civic Education & Democratic Participation
Active Citizenship and Governance Awareness.
. Build understanding of civic rights and duties.
. Promote democratic participation and accountability.
. Strengthen advocacy and citizen engagement skills.
Entrepreneurship & Economic Empowerment
Social Entrepreneurship for Change
. Encourage entrepreneurial thinking for social good.
. Equip youth with basic business and project management skills.
. Promote sustainable and inclusive economic solutions.
Public Speaking & Communication
Voice for Change
. Structure and delivery of speeches.
. Body language, tone, and audience engagement.
. Overcoming stage fear and using storytelling.

Tomorrow is better than today
The Elikia Afrika program serves as a roadmap to nurture young change-makers capable of rebuilding communities with peace, justice, and integrity. The program envisions an empowered generation leading Africa with ethics, wisdom, compassion, and hope Elikia, the very word for “hope” in Lingala.
